Ederveen, a village under Ede, pairs a small-town scale with solid figures. With a 9.1 for safety, an 8.1 for amenities and an overall 8.8, it does well, though community sticks at 5.2. Over forty percent of households have children. Homes average €505,000, above the national median. A restaurant is 3.2 kilometres away, further than the supermarket and GP, which sit around the corner.

How is the grade for Ederveen dorp calculated?

Ederveen dorp scores 8.8 overall. That is a weighted average of five pillars: safety, amenities, housing, social & income, and nature & quiet. Each pillar compares this neighbourhood with every other neighbourhood in the Netherlands, using open data from CBS and the police.

Is Ederveen dorp a safe neighbourhood?

Ederveen dorp scores 9.1 on safety, based on registered crimes per 1,000 people present (13.0 per year). The national median is around 24.1.
